Latest Patents

Yuming Feng holds a patent for an invention titled "Electromagnetic shielding filler, electromagnetic shielding coating comprising the same, preparation method and use thereof." This invention relates to a shielding filler that utilizes melamine sponge as a carrier, with surfaces covered in FeO/graphene. The electromagnetic shielding coating is created by mixing two components in a specific molar ratio, resulting in a coating layer that is both electrically conductive and magnetically inductive. The coating is lightweight and can be applied using various methods, including brush coating, spray coating, or roller coating.
